Banking guest speaker connects study with industry
OPAIC master’s students gained insight into real-world banking practices during a guest lecture for the Management Information Systems course last week.
Lecturer Nishika Jayasinghe organised the session and invited ASB Bank Technical Analyst Hemantha Niranjan as the guest speaker.
Hemantha showed how the concepts taught in the course are applied in real banking environments.
The session helped students connect classroom learning with industry practice and gain a clearer understanding of how their studies align with current expectations in the banking sector.
Nishika said the presentation was highly valuable for our students as it helped bridge the gap between theoretical knowledge and practical application.
“This session gave students greater confidence and a clearer understanding of how the knowledge they gain through OPAIC courses aligns with current industry practices and expectations.”
